Whispers of the Demon's Blade: The Loner's Quest
In the heart of the ancient, mist-enshrouded mountains of Liangzhou, there existed a legend that had been whispered through generations. It spoke of a demonic force that had once terrorized the land, corrupting the hearts of the people and bending the will of the strongest warriors. The curse, a malevolent force, had been sealed away by a hero of yore, his body forever entombed in the very mountains that had witnessed his greatest triumph and his darkest defeat.
In the year of the Tiger, a young man named Jing Feng emerged from the shadow of these mountains. His eyes, like twin stars, held the fire of a thousand suns, and his hands, once soft and uncalloused, were now scarred by countless hours of martial arts training. Jing Feng was no ordinary man; he was the descendant of the ancient hero, bound by a destiny that he could neither escape nor ignore.
The legend spoke of the Demon's Blade, a weapon forged from the essence of the demonic force itself. It was said that the blade could only be wielded by one who had faced the demon within and emerged unscathed. Jing Feng knew that his path was clear; he must find the Demon's Blade and break the curse that bound him and his lineage.
As he ventured forth, Jing Feng encountered a world that had changed little since the days of his ancestor. The land was a patchwork of kingdoms, each ruled by a warlord with ambitions as vast as the mountains themselves. The people lived in fear, for the demonic influence had not entirely vanished. It slithered through the shadows, corrupting the hearts of the weak and manipulating the strong.
Jing Feng's journey began in the bustling streets of the capital, where he encountered a young woman named Xiao Li, a martial artist in her own right. She was on a quest of her own, seeking to uncover the truth behind her father's mysterious disappearance. Xiao Li's presence was like a beacon in the darkness, and Jing Feng felt an inexplicable connection to her.
Together, they set out into the wilds, facing trials that tested their strength, their resolve, and their trust in one another. They encountered treacherous bandits, cunning spies, and even the specters of the past, all of whom sought to prevent them from reaching their goal. Each encounter brought them closer to the heart of the curse, but also to the truth of Xiao Li's lineage.
The journey took them to the forbidden city of the Demons, a place where the veil between worlds was thin and the demonic influence was strongest. Here, they discovered that Xiao Li was not just a descendant of a great warrior but a princess of the Demons, a fact her father had kept hidden from her. The revelation was a bombshell, but it also shed light on the true nature of the curse.
As they ventured deeper into the city, they were met with betrayal at every turn. The Demon's Blade, it turned out, was not a simple weapon but a sentient entity, bound to the heart of the curse. It could only be wielded by one who had the purest heart, yet the blade itself had been corrupted by the influence of the demonic force.
In the heart of the city, Jing Feng and Xiao Li faced their greatest challenge. They had to confront the Demon's Blade within themselves, to confront the darkness that had been growing within them. Through a series of trials, they discovered that the true power of the blade lay not in its ability to harm but in its potential to heal.
The climax of their quest came in the grandest of spectacles, as the demonic force that had once threatened the world was unleashed once more. Jing Feng and Xiao Li stood at the forefront, their hearts and minds aligned against the darkness. In a battle that raged through the night, they used the Demon's Blade to banish the curse, not by destroying it, but by transforming it into a force for good.
The ending of their quest was bittersweet. The curse was broken, but the cost was high. Xiao Li, who had been the linchpin of their journey, was forced to choose between her destiny as a princess of the Demons and her love for Jing Feng. In a final act of sacrifice, she chose the former, allowing Jing Feng to return to his life, free from the curse.
Jing Feng, now a man of peace, carried the memory of Xiao Li with him. He returned to the mountains, where he had first emerged, and built a school for martial arts, teaching the ways of the warrior to those who sought to protect their land from the darkness that lurked in the shadows. And so, the legend of the Demon's Blade and the hero who had broken its curse lived on, a tale of redemption and the enduring power of the human spirit.
